WebJul 14, 2024 · Soak the bean seeds overnight. Soak enough so each person in the class gets a bean. Wet the cotton wool and place it inside the container. Add a few bean seeds to each container on top of the cotton wool and put the container in a bright window. As the cotton wool dries out, water it. Have pupils record how the beans grow and change.
